Just Found My Dream Green Machine! (G6012AN)
Ever since I started playing acoustic guitar 10 years ago, I have never given up hope that I would find my dream green guitar. Back in 2001, I almost bought a green Dillion at a pawnshop in Fort Wayne, IN, but was advised not to go to pawnshops for my first guitar. So my first guitar ended up being an Epiphone Hummingbird (and I still have that one in my Great Archive).
Still I found no green guitars all those years--until last week, when I found one on eBay. It will go well with my green violin!
It's a G6012AN Anniversary two-tone smoke green Rancher Sweet 16. It came with its original "Gretsch" case. It has two unusual features--a "stinger" headstock (back of headstock painted black), and a label that erroneously calls it a "Historic", even though the G6012 Rancher Sweet 16s were NEVER part of the Historic Series. The label has the right model number though--G6012AN. The serial number is JT03032356, indicating manufacture in Japan at the Terada factory, March 2003, number 2356 of the line (all guitars made there that year).
